Frequently asked questions

How do I specify which pages to remove?
Use a comma-separated, 1-indexed list of page numbers or ranges. A single number removes one page (e.g. "5"). A dash defines a range (e.g. "7-9"). Example: "2,4,7-9" deletes pages 2, 4, and 7 through 9.
What happens to the pages I don't list?
Every page not included in your list is kept, in the same order as the original document, and combined into a single output PDF.
Can I remove every page from the PDF?
No, at least one page must remain in the output. If you want to remove all pages, there would be nothing left to download.
How is this different from Split PDF?
Split PDF extracts the pages or ranges you choose into separate files. Remove Pages does the opposite: you specify what to delete, and everything else is kept together in a single PDF.
Will the quality of my PDF be affected?
No. Removing pages does not re-encode or modify any content. The remaining pages are copied exactly as they appear in the original.
